From 539de1c6af63071c1da9ed5db668c500f8993a03 Mon Sep 17 00:00:00 2001 From: Yaroslav Brustinov Date: Tue, 20 Dec 2016 17:47:22 +0200 Subject: Fix the way root user is being determined in Python; Running scapy_daemon_server and stl_rpc_proxy now should work without tty; Change-Id: Id70be83956a9b8279197c68dd58b674e972fc1a9 Signed-off-by: Yaroslav Brustinov --- scripts/dpdk_setup_ports.py |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) (limited to 'scripts/dpdk_setup_ports.py') diff --git a/scripts/dpdk_setup_ports.py b/scripts/dpdk_setup_ports.py index fce099b5..1edf8f87 100755 --- a/scripts/dpdk_setup_ports.py +++ b/scripts/dpdk_setup_ports.py @@ -13,7 +13,6 @@ import shlex import traceback from collections import defaultdict, OrderedDict from distutils.util import strtobool -import getpass import subprocess import platform @@ -984,7 +983,7 @@ To see more detailed info on interfaces (table): def main (): try: - if getpass.getuser() != 'root': + if os.getuid() != 0: raise DpdkSetup('Please run this program as root/with sudo') process_options () -- cgit 1.2.3-korg